RAGGEDY ROBIN COOKIES
I got this recipe from my home economics teacher when I was in the 8th grade almost 40 years ago. Even after all these years, they are still my favorite cookies. A chocolate oatmeal non-bake cookie. Trust me, they are delicious!
Provided by Regina00214
Categories Drop Cookies
Time 30m
Yield 12-16 cookies, 4-6 serving(s)
Number Of Ingredients 8
Steps:
- Mix together in medium saucepan, sugar and cocoa.
- Add milk and butter, stir over medium heat and bring to a rolling boil.
- Boil for one minute, then remove pan from heat.
- Quickly add vanilla, peanut butter, and oatmeal.
- Drop by teaspoonfuls onto wax paper or aluminum foil.
- Let cool for 20 minutes.

RAGGEDY ANN COOKIES
A soft chewy cookie that is good in picnic lunches, afternoon tea or served with a tall cold glass of lemonade.
Provided by Vonieta Stogner
Categories Drop Cookies
Yield 72
Number Of Ingredients 13
Steps:
- Preheat o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C). Line baking sheets with parchment paper.
- Cream the shortening, brown sugar and white sugar together until light and fluffy. Beat in the vanilla salt and eggs.
- Sift the flour, baking soda and baking powder, add to the creamed mixture and stir to combine. Stir in the oats, rice cereal, coconut and nuts. Mix to combine.
- Form dough into walnut sized balls and place on the prepared baking sheets. Bake at 350 degrees F (175 degrees C) for 10 minutes. These cookies should still be very soft when taken from the oven. Place on a cooling rack and let cool completely before storing in airtight containers.
